This is where egaming compliance comes into play.
egaming compliance refers to the set of rules and regulations that online gaming operators must adhere to in order to ensure that their games are fair and safe for players. These regulations cover a wide range of issues, including responsible gaming practices, data protection, fraud prevention, and anti-money laundering measures. By complying with these regulations, online gaming operators can ensure that their games are conducted in a transparent and secure manner, and that players are protected from potential harm.
One of the key aspects of egaming compliance is the need for online gaming operators to implement responsible gaming practices. This includes measures such as age verification checks to prevent minors from accessing online gaming sites, limits on the amount of money that players can deposit and wager, and self-exclusion options for players who may be struggling with problem gambling. By implementing these measures, online gaming operators can help to promote responsible gaming behavior and ensure that their games are enjoyed in a safe and responsible manner.
Data protection is another important aspect of egaming compliance. Online gaming operators collect a significant amount of personal and financial information from their players, including names, addresses, and payment details. It is crucial that this information is stored and processed securely to prevent it from falling into the wrong hands. By implementing robust data protection measures, including encryption and secure server technology, online gaming operators can help to protect their players’ information and ensure that it is not misused or compromised.
Fraud prevention is also a key aspect of egaming compliance. Online gaming operators must take steps to prevent fraudsters from accessing their games and exploiting vulnerabilities in the system to cheat other players. This includes implementing strong authentication measures, monitoring gameplay for suspicious activity, and taking action against players who are found to be engaging in fraudulent behavior. By taking a proactive approach to fraud prevention, online gaming operators can help to protect the integrity of their games and ensure that all players have a fair and enjoyable gaming experience.
In addition to responsible gaming practices, data protection, and fraud prevention, egaming compliance also encompasses anti-money laundering measures. Online gaming sites are a potential target for money launderers looking to disguise the origins of their ill-gotten gains, so it is crucial that online gaming operators take steps to prevent this type of activity. This includes implementing robust Know Your Customer (KYC) procedures to verify the identities of their players, monitoring transactions for suspicious activity, and reporting any suspicious transactions to the relevant authorities. By complying with these regulations, online gaming operators can help to prevent money laundering and protect the integrity of their games.
